With 17 years of creation, the Drug Marketing and Distributor Company (Emcomed) today constitutes a giant in its work as it is in charge of taking to the entire country both the inputs for the production of drugs and the finished products that are so much needed. to maintain health.
With regard to this important work, CubaPLUS Magazine exclusively interviewed Onecys Perdomo &Aálvarez, Commercial Director of the entity, present as an exhibitor at the XV Health for All Fair that takes place in the capital's PABEXPO venue, with the presence of representatives of some 118 companies from 40 markets.
Our company is a marketer and distributor of medicines and is also a logistics company with a national scope, present throughout the country, for which it has 25 distribution centers that include two transport bases, located in Havana and Santiago. from Cuba," he explained.
We are in charge of extracting from the port and airports the raw materials to guarantee the production of medicines that are made in the nation and that constitute 60% of the basic table -627 types of drugs-. The rest is imported based on the demands of the Ministry of Public Health and we transport and market them throughout the national territory, she added.
When answering a question about the objective that prompted Emcomed to participate in the fair, she said that "it is a great opportunity to be present at a fair like this, although we are well established at the national level, our presence allows us to better understand what our function is within of the country's medical insurance chain.
Referring to the activity as a 3PL logistics company -provides transport and storage services- of the BioCubaFarma group, she pointed out that Emcomed's future aspirations are to reach the 4PL category, which is the one that fully coordinates logistics, since it has its own resources and technologies to design and manage comprehensive logistics for its customers.
As a logistics operator, she added, we have many projects in the Mariel special zone. We have a space there so that, in the medium-term, we can become the logistics operator in the area because we have the experience. They would be transportation services, storage facilities to meet the essential conditions for that. We have certifications of good practices and sanitary licenses but, in addition, we have the appropriate establishments so that at a certain moment they are depositary of products that require it".
Finally she spoke of a beautiful program, in which Emcomed has a fundamental contribution. &We are part of a very nice project with the Institute of Nephrology. We make home deliveries of peritoneal dialysis products for patients who dialyze at home and we make home deliveries throughout the country, which constitutes an important aid to the lives of these people".
